Hugh Augustine Davey was born on September 8, 1923, in County Down, Northern Ireland. He was the son of Joseph and Margaret Davey, of Andover, Massachusetts.
Hugh served in the 434 Squadron of the Royal Canadian Air Force as a Pilot Officer during World War II. He was Killed in Action on February 21, 1945, when his Lancaster aircraft #NG 497 returned from the target but had been badly damaged by cannon shells when it was shot down by a German fighter aircraft.
